Transaction f08810f60cbfe706906fc87fa1c3778fc59bdefdd89104db8ad9b9319c63751a

154 Input
2 Outputs
  • f08810f60cbfe706906fc87fa1c3778fc59bdefdd89104db8ad9b9319c63751a:0
  • value  389226
    address  32oU1bAPCaEEHsr1EYC4rTbJ4UX4SJTHQM
  • f08810f60cbfe706906fc87fa1c3778fc59bdefdd89104db8ad9b9319c63751a:1
  • value  97762877
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s